Technical Resourcer | Fruition Group Ireland
We are seeking an experienced QA Tester to join our QA Test Team on a contract basis. The ideal candidate will bring proven expertise in SQL and Life assurance policy's This role will suit someone with a strong background in validating complex data flows, ensuring data integrity, and supporting transformation programmes within financial or enterprise environments.
This is a hybrid role, with two days on-site and three days remote.
Qualifications & Experience

IT Degree or equivalent technical experience (must be evidenced)
Minimum 6+ years’ experience as an IT Tester, with a proven track record in complex environments
Direct experience testing Life Assurance products or within a Life or Financial Services company (non-negotiable)
Experience testing Azure platform solutions (must be recent and demonstrable)
Experience testing GPT prompts and system integrations
Expertise in API testing (including standards, techniques, and tools)
Strong knowledge of programming languages, databases, and test environments
Proven experience working in an Agile environment in close proximity to business stakeholders
Demonstrable ability to work independently under direction from the QA Lead, including taking ownership of large tasks and delivering end-to-end solutions
Ability to work under pressure and meet tight deadlines

Technical Skills (Must Have)

Expert understanding of the Software Testing Life Cycle (STLC)
Excellent knowledge of SQL and database structures for test planning and execution
Proven experience with test automation, integration, UAT, and regression testing techniques
Strong experience with API testing tools and frameworks
Experience with seeding and integration of data within test environments
Expert knowledge of testing tools and industry-recognised standards
Ability to recommend and implement new industry-standard tools and technologies
Experience creating and implementing standards for API and Automated UI test cases

Desirable Qualifications

Experience with Python (advantageous)
Relevant certifications (e.g., ISTQB Advanced, Azure certifications)
Exposure to continuous improvement initiatives and process optimisation

Key Responsibilities

Analyse new requirements, developments, and system changes to identify all testing needs (test scripts, API, system, regression, etc.)
Design, execute, and maintain UI, regression, and service test cases to a high standard
Liaise with key stakeholders to ensure project requirements and timelines are met; communicate progress and elevate issues as needed
Engage and influence in workshops and meetings with internal and external stakeholders for efficient delivery
Attend stand‑ups and project meetings as QA representative during delivery cycles
Raise, document, and manage defects found in testing, including blockers
Conduct peer reviews of test designs, ensuring adherence to internal standards and risk assessment protocols
Define and coordinate maintenance of regression/automation/API test packs post‑release
Assist in planning activities, managing team workloads, and resource allocation as required
Proactively contribute to continuous improvement initiatives within the team
Recommend and implement new industry‑standard tools and technologies
Ensure all system changes are tested and signed off before production deployment, adhering to internal QA standards and strategy
Self‑starter: Able to come up to speed quickly and work independently with minimal supervision. Takes initiative to troubleshoot, identify root causes, and propose well‑reasoned solutions.
Strong organisational skills: Able to prioritise and coordinate multiple tasks to tight timelines
Excellent communication and influencing skills: Able to engage effectively with business partners and technical teams
Teamwork and collaboration: Proven ability to work under direction from a QA Lead and provide guidance within project teams, and collaborate cross‑functionally
Critical analysis and risk assessment: Strong problem‑solving and decision‑making skills, with the ability to analyse and resolve QA‑related issues. Strong analytical mindset with the ability to investigate issues end‑to‑end.
Drive for results: Personally effective, takes responsibility for delivery, and manages time well
Adaptability: Comfortable working in a fast‑paced, change‑ready, and agile environment
